How Do You Make A Celebration Of Life Program

The celebration of the service of life can include music (click here for our guide to the best songs to celebrate life), dancing, storytelling, or anything else that the family believes celebrates the life and fulfills the deceased. The celebration of life may involve reading, poetry, or prayers, but it’s more likely that you’ll see and hear guests tell funny stories about happy times or share touching memories of a lost loved one. A memorial service is usually held shortly after the death of a loved one, while memorial services and wakes may be held later, giving you time to plan and organize the event.
If you want to plan an event or service to honor a loved one or family member, you can start the planning process by creating a guest list, setting a budget, and choosing a location and date. Whether it’s days, weeks, months, or years after your loved one’s death, a unique celebration of their life is a wonderful way to honor them. Honoring a lost loved one through a memorial service or celebration of life can provide tremendous comfort and immeasurable support. Especially if the person you lost was happy and joyful, the best way to honor them is through joyful and joyful service. Ultimately, choosing how to honor a lost person is a very personal decision.
Their lives and their existence are cause for joy, even after they are gone. The idea that life is cyclical and that new growth and new life will continue to sprout long after we are gone is a sentimental and symbolic way to celebrate a loved one. A sincere need for mutual support in difficult times and the memory that life will go on are also good reasons to reunite after the death of a loved one.
Every service is different, every celebration of life is different, and every funeral home is different. The funeral service may be held at a place of worship or funeral home, although many other places may be considered if the body is not present.
